View Single Post
Old 05-08-2020, 07:29 AM   #6
davidfor
Grand Sorcerer
dav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.davidfor ought to be getting tired of karma fortunes by now.
 
Posts: 24,905
Karma: 47303824
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
Quote:
Originally Posted by MeBlue View Post
Is there any way to bypass that? If I edit the metadata it will generate that red border around title_sort. If I edit the book, I can change the title_sort, but that is not reflected in Calibre.
The red border means that the title sort field isn't in sync with the title field. Pressing the arrow between them will sync the title sort to the title field based on the rules being used. But, it isn't actually wrong to leave then out of sync.

If you change the OPF in the editor, you can come back to the metadata editor and fetch the metadata from the book again. This should get the change to the title_sort that you made. And if you edit the book again before doing this, calibre will update the metadata as it opens the book. There is an option to turn this off. This might be what is happening when you see the change revert.

The other thing is that the rules generating the title sort are language dependent, and can be changed with some tweaks. There is a tweak to set what is considered an article for different languages. If the books language is not English, "The" will probably not be treated as an article.
davidfor is offline   Reply With Quote